This post explains how Airbnb safely upgrades Istio across tens of thousands of pods on dozens of Kubernetes clusters without workload team coordination.
•Airbnb follows Istio's canary upgrade model, running two Istiod revisions simultaneously so workloads on different versions can still communicate
•A rollouts.yml file controls version distribution per namespace using consistent hashing, enabling gradual, deterministic rollouts and easy rollbacks
•Krispr, an in-house mutation framework, injects the correct Istio revision label at CI time and again at pod admission, decoupling upgrades from workload deployments
•Node and pod max lifetime of two weeks guarantees all Kubernetes workloads are upgraded within four weeks even without redeployment
•
VM workloads are handled separately via a pull-based agent that reads rollouts.yml and applies the correct Istio version on each VM
